2020 ASH WEDNESDAY SCHEDULE: WEDNESDAY, FEBRUARY 26

9:00am - Ash Wednesday Mass (St. Alphonsus) 7:00pm - Ash Wednesday Mass (Holy Name of Jesus)

School Celebrations on Ash Wednesday: Distribution of Ashes (No Mass): 11:00am - St. Theresa School; 12:30pm - St. Francis School; 1:30pm - Our Lady of Fatima School.

Ash Wednesday is a day of Fasting & Abstinence, this means: Ash Wednesday and Good Friday are obligatory days of fasting and abstinence for Catholics. In addition, Fridays during Lent are obligatory days of abstinence from meat. Fasting means a person is permitted to eat one full meal. Two smaller meals may also be taken, but they are not to equal that of a full meal. Fasting is obligatory for those aged 18 - 59, and encouraged for others unless medical conditions prevent from doing so.
